TomTom has announced its latest XXL 530S and XXL 540S navigation devices. These devices come integrated with the finest technologies. Plus, these devices allow TomTom to offer its famous IQ Routes Technology on a gigantic 5-inch screen.
The IQ Route technology is founded on speed measurements dependent on the exact time of the day/night alongside the specific road, whether it is a large highway or a small local road. In this way, it ensures a faster route in addition to the least fuel consumption which finally gives rise to cost effectiveness.

These devices are featured with pre-loaded full maps of US and Canada. They also come with the Map Share Technology, which helps modify directions, POIs (Point of Interest) and street names that others have made.
Besides, these devices also come featured with Help Me! Menu, this makes the accessibility of local emergency services possible as well as accessible when the menu incorporated attributes optimal icons for easy usage. These devices are additionally featured with the Go EasyPort mount, Fold and also Home, a free desktop application.
As the reviews, the XXL 540S is also touted to have more to swank in conjunction with sophisticated lane guidance and extra maps of Mexico. The device has got a stylish look with a black finish.
The TomTom XXL 540S and XXL 530S come with their respective price tag of around $279.95 $299.95 (approx Rs. 14,586) and (approx Rs. 13,615). These devices are slated to be shipped in October in the US and Canada via retailers.
